[Tfug] Holy Wars!

Robert Hunter hunter at tfug.org
Thu Mar 13 07:13:05 MST 2008


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On Wed, Mar 12, 2008 at 08:18:58PM -0700, John Gruenenfelder wrote:
> Oh my, yes.  It's called Eclipse!
> 
> I really do find it super useful when I'm programming in Java (otherwise I'm
> an EMACS guy), but it will make any machine beg for mercy regardless of
> memory capacity or CPU speed.
> 
> Sure, it's not strictly an editor, but then neither is EMACS, right?  :)

Yes, there many things that are impressive about eclipse, including
it's liberal use of your systems resources. ;-)

Actually, there are a few neat things from eclipse I'd like to see in
other dev environments.  One of them is a sane build-tool like Ant.
Go ahead, throw things at me -- I have on my +5 chain-mail!

<rant> One of the inhibiting factors of starting or migrating dev
projects between different environments, IMO, is the necessity of
having to reconfigure the entire build process.  I think this is more
an issue now than in the past, given the larger number of developers,
and tools to choose from.  Some projects, out of practical necessity,
standardize on environments like Eclipse, KDevelop, or autotools.
IMO, this requirement would not be necessary if they used a standard,
but also extensible, build system, such as Ant.  Imagine being able to
work on a project with you favorite IDE ( e.g., Emacs + a nice wide
screen terminal ;-) ), in tandem with colleagues who are more inclined
to the clicky sort of tools.  You make changes to the code, tweak the
build settings*, and commit.  Your colleagues update, and everything
works seamlessly in their KDevelop sessions.  It can happen! </rant>

Rob


*for a really cool, validating, XML-mode for Emacs, see:
 http://www.thaiopensource.com/nxml-mode/

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FH2TZxJ1pz6tWxufARAr3hAJwMF+6jEC6mwq9JxgFLqHA+ARvKIQCeO2hF
LRnVjDMN7r0VK8SmkV9i1KM=
=ALnG
-----END PGP SIGNATURE-----




More information about the tfug mailing list